Chocolate Cherry Cupcakes with Cherry Frosting Recipe

Dessert

Gluten free, dairy free, vegan friendly

American

Chocolate Cherry Cupcakes with a perfectly moist gluten free chocolate cupcake, all-natural maraschino cherry in the center and cherry frosting. If you are a maraschino cherry fan, this cupcake is calling your name. (Gluten Free, Dairy Free & Vegan Friendly)
Print Recipe

Yield: 12

Prep Time:15 min

Cook Time:25 min

Total Time:40 min

Ingredients:

  • ½ cup cocoa powder
  • ½ cup gluten-free baking flour
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 cup cane sugar
  • ¼ cup brown sugar
  • 2 eggs, room temperature
  • 3 Tablespoons butter (or dairy-free alternative), melted and cooled
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up milk (or dairy-free alternative)
  • 12 maraschino cherries without stems

Cherry Frosting

  • ¼ cup butter, softened (or dairy-free alternative)
  • ¼ cup cherry juice from maraschino cherry jar + more for see instructions
  • 3 cups powdered sugar

Directions: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
  • 2. Prepare muffin pan with baking cupcake liners.
  • 3. In a medium bowl, whisk together cocoa powder, fl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, sugar, brown sugar.
  • 4. Make a well. Add eggs, butter, vanilla extract and milk. Whisk together until fully incorporated.
  • 5. Spoon 1 Tablespoon into each cupcake liner. Place one cherry into center of each cupcake. Cover with additional 1 Tablespoon of cake batter to cover.
  • 6. Bake 21-24 minutes until toothpick comes out clean.
  • 7. Meanwhile prepare the frosting. In a medium mixing bowl beat butter with mixer until creamy, add cherry juice (be careful for splatter the juice will stain).
  • 8. Slowly incorporate and beat powdered sugar into the mixture. If the frosting is still a little runny at more powdered sugar, if it is a little stiff add additional cherry juice. Repeat this process still frosting is creamy but holds stiff peaks.

Notes

Frosting Tip: To make super creamy frosting. Once frosting is the desired consistency for you, beat an additional 2-3 minutes to create super light, smooth and fluffy frosting.

    Can you use oat flour instead of just any gluten free flour?

    Reply
    • Lindsay says

      August 1, 2020 at 3:26 am

      oat flour is very different and will create very dense results.
